It REALLY depends on how much you want to spend--- and what you REALLY intend to do with the camera.

INTENTION: Take nice photos of flowers, where you can see some great detail. Also, something that I can take around on trips, shoot some nice memories.... by no means professional, but better than my little canon pocket-sized digital :)


Things that you should consider---

megapixels--- 10 or 12 is plenty, for bud porn, dont go much below 6.
JUST TO CLARIFY: at least 6 megapixels or more, 12 being virtually unnecessary for my intended use? (I love how you said Bud Porn)

macro mode: how close will the lens sharply focus?
self timer: lets you set off the camera with no camera shake for close-up bud pix
tripod socket---yup a tripod is handy--especially the little table top ones for bud pix...
"hot shoe" for attaching an external flash
what kind of memory cards does it use?? stick with either CF or SD memory cards.
